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
075120038 30828804 5041240 7130050 4161733
77 104 4610882
77 104 4610882
40150 30599812 48063000 381152241 524
All about undefined
Interested in learning more?
77 104 4610882
40150 30599812 48063000 381152241 524
See more
9020273 73641
95457 082657187 1322861901
See more
9754925393 902883625 34923630
51094 26 9460874360
See more